
"Viral hit Schedule 1 sees players build a drug-dealing empire from the ground up, and the new update adds some new obstacles for the player's rise to power--as well as new possibilities. The Benzies family will only be introduced once the player has unlocked a few customers in Westville, and once you're on their radar, they'll interfere with your business through ambushes, theft, robbing your dealers, and stealing your customers. You'll also be able to truce with the Benzies, unlocking new cartel-player deals."
"Once you've completed the rival cartel's full storyline, you'll be able to purchase the new Hyland Manor property. The update also comes with a few new features, including a graffiti system that can be used to reduce the cartel's influence and gain XP. Cartel influence is something you'll have to be aware of as you progress through Schedule 1--different areas on the map will now be locked if cartel influence is too high, and players will have to reduce the influence in order to unlock new regions."
